Cream charger tanks, frequently described as N2O cream charger tanks, are small cylinders filled with nitrous oxide (N2O). These tanks are designed to be used with whipped cream dispensers or siphons, allowing for the quick infusion of gas into liquids. The outcome? Light and fluffy whipped cream that holds its shape longer than conventional methods.
The mechanics behind these tanks is rather simple yet fascinating. When you place an N2O nang canister into a whipped cream dispenser and press the lever, the gas is released under pressure. This nitrous oxide blends with the liquid, producing bubbles that broaden upon release, leading to a velvety texture.

While nitrous oxide is the market requirement for whipping agents, some may think about alternatives like CO2 for carbonation functions. However, it's vital to comprehend that while CO2 adds fizz, it won't provide the exact same velvety texture.
A nang canister is another name for a little cylinder containing nitrous oxide used mostly in combination with whipped cream dispensers.
When utilized properly following manufacturer standards, cream chargers are safe. It's essential to avoid inhaling nitrous oxide recreationally due to prospective health risks.
Typically, an N2O tank contains adequate gas to whip roughly half a liter of cream per charge; nevertheless, Visit this website use frequency will figure out for how long they last overall.
Most commercial battery chargers are designed as single-use products and shouldn't be refilled due to safety issues concerning pressure levels.
Overcharging may cause extreme pressure build-up in your dispenser which could cause malfunction or damage.
You can acquire lawfully from kitchen area supply shops or online merchants concentrating on cooking materials; however, age constraints may apply depending upon your location.
